Insights from Revelation 14
Revelation 14 is a chapter brimming with messages for today. It speaks of three angels delivering crucial messages to the world. These messages emphasize worship, warning, and wisdom. They call you to worship God and recognize His sovereignty. By studying Revelation 14, you’ll see how these messages apply to your life and how they call you to live with purpose and faith. The Three Angels’ Messages
The three angels’ messages are central to Adventist prophecy. They carry themes of judgment, warning, and hope. These messages aren’t just historical; they resonate with you today. They remind you of God’s call to live faithfully and prepare for His return. By embracing these messages, you find guidance for your journey and a clearer understanding of God’s expectations.
